On 21/05/2017 05:32, Wanpeng Li wrote:
> vmx_cancel_hv_timer
>   vCPU0's vmx->hv_deadline_tsc = -1
> 
>   preempt occur
> 
>                                      clear preemption timer field in CPU1's 
> active vmcs
>                                      vCPU0's apic_timer.hv_timer_in_use = 
> false
> vmx_vcpu_run(vCPU0)
>   vmx_arm_hv_timer
>     if (vmx->hv_deadline_tsc == -1)
>         nothing change
>        
> handle_preemption_timer(vCPU0)
>   kvm_lapic_expired_hv_timer
>     WARN_ON(!apic->lapic_timer.hv_timer_in_use); 
>   
> Preemption can occur during cancel preemption timer, and there will be 
> inconsistent 
> status in lapic, vmx and vmcs field. This patch fixes it by disable 
> preemption for 
> cancelling preemption timer.

I see, so the purpose is to serialize against kvm_arch_vcpu_load.  Nice
catch, I've queued the patch for kvm/master.
